Is Duncan, OK a Good Place to Live?

Duncan receives an overall livability grade of C+ (57/100), suggesting room for improvement compared to other areas in Oklahoma. Safety scores D (36/100). Affordability scores B (64/100) with a median household income of $56,934 and median home values around $129,300.

About 19.2%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the unemployment rate is 4.7%. 71% of housing is owner-occupied. The median age is 39.
